This property will be useful for libvirt, as libvirt already has logic based on low-level feature bits (not feature names), so it will be really easy to convert the current libvirt logic to something using the "feature-words" property.
The property will have two main use cases: - Checking host capabilities, by checking the features of the "host" CPU model - Checking which features are enabled on each CPU model
Example output:
$ ./QMP/qmp --path=/tmp/m qom-get --path=/machine/unattached/device[1] --property=feature-words
If I'm not mistaken, the QMP counterpart that libvirt will use is: { "execute":"qom-get", "arguments": { "path":"/machine/unattached/device[1]", "property":"feature-words" } }
item[0].cpuid-register: EDX item[0].cpuid-input-eax: 2147483658 item[0].features: 0 item[1].cpuid-register: EAX item[1].cpuid-input-eax: 1073741825 item[1].features: 0 item[2].cpuid-register: EDX item[2].cpuid-input-eax: 3221225473 item[2].features: 0 item[3].cpuid-register: ECX item[3].cpuid-input-eax: 2147483649 item[3].features: 101 item[4].cpuid-register: EDX item[4].cpuid-input-eax: 2147483649 item[4].features: 563346425 item[5].cpuid-register: EBX item[5].cpuid-input-eax: 7 item[5].features: 0 item[5].cpuid-input-ecx: 0 item[6].cpuid-register: ECX item[6].cpuid-input-eax: 1 item[6].features: 2155880449 item[7].cpuid-register: EDX item[7].cpuid-input-eax: 1 item[7].features: 126614521
And this would then be returned as a JSON array containing struct members looking like this:
+{ 'type': 'X86CPUFeatureWordInfo', + 'data': { 'cpuid-input-eax': 'int', + '*cpuid-input-ecx': 'int', + 'cpuid-register': 'X86CPURegister32', + 'features': 'int' } }
